Primary Circuit to Packet Solutions
APPLICATION APPLICATION DESCRIPTION BENEFIT
SS7 transport over IP Provides transport of dedicated T1 or E1 SS7 links over the
IP/MPLS network.
Eliminates point-to-point T1 and E1 links required for
transporting SS7 trac and allows convergence over the
IP/MPLS network.
TDM over IP solution The provisioning of point-to-point TDM trunks over the IP
network does not require changes to the TDM equipment.
Allows the continued use and investment protection of the
existing TDM equipment or an easy transition path from a
TDM network to an IP network.
PBX interconnect
over IP solution
Provides T1, E1 and 4WE&M trunking for PBX
interconnection over the IP network.
Reduce WAN infrastructure cost through the elimination
of costly point-to-point circuits and leased lines required
to support TDM and/or ATM networks. Circuit emulation
over IP enables seamless transition to IP transport without
upgrading your entire infrastructure to VoIP.
PBX Extension over IP
with 2WFXS/2WFXO
Provides two-wire analog PBX to phone extensions over IP
and two-wire PBX to PBX/central oce connections over IP.
Private-line automatic ringdown (PLAR) is also supported.
Reduces IT expenditures by enabling PBX tie lines to
be transported across less expensive IP data network
connections. Analog voice trac is converted to IP,
eliminating the need for costly T1 tie lines.
Leased line extension
over IP solution
Supports standards-based encapsulation and DS0
bundling. IETF PWE3 RFCs, SAToP and CESoPSN are
supported.
Enables full, fractional and DS0 bundling and mapping of
T1 and E1 service provisioned over an IP/MPLS network and
enables interoperability between vendors.
Radio over IP solution Allows for connectivity of analog and digital radios
over IP networks.
Provides a mechanism to deploy these systems over IP
networks while maintaining critical communications.
Serial encryption
over IP solution
Provides transport of KG/KIV bit-synchronous cipher text
across an IP network.
Eliminates the need to deploy TDM or ATM equipment—
saving cost, time, space, and power.
T1 and E1 backup over IP Point-to-point T1 or E1 circuits can be automatically backed
up over the IP/MPLS network.
Eliminates redundant point-to-point circuit costs. The end
application does not need to detect IP, saving soware and
hardware upgrade costs.
Features and Benefits
Key features and benefits of the CTP Series Circuit to Packet Platforms include the following.
FEATURE FEATURE DESCRIPTION BENEFIT
Soware circuit
provisioning
EIA530, RS-232, V.35, 4WTO, T1, and E1 circuit types are
soware configured including the line encoding, clocking,
rates, and IP settings.
The network quickly fulfills new and changing end user
requirements without deploying excess hardware.
Scalable product family A family of four CTP Series Circuit to Packet Platforms
provides dierent port densities. Products can address the
requirements of small remote sites through large central
network hubs.
Network designers control costs by selecting the CTP Series
Circuit to Packet Platforms most suitable for the site when
considering circuit quantities and anticipated growth.
